Izici zomkhiqizo ze-ZYD zokuhlunga uwoyela we-vacuum ezinezigaba ezimbili ezisebenza kahle kakhulu

I-vacuum ephezulu kanye nesivinini esikhulu sokumpompa: Le mishini ine-vacuum degree ephezulu kakhulu kanye nekhono eliphezulu lokumpompa, elingahlangabezana nezidingo ze-transformer body vacuum pumping kanye nomjovo kawoyela we-vacuum ezindaweni zokufaka noma zokulungisa, futhi ngesikhathi esifanayo uqedele ukwelashwa okujulile kokuhlanzeka kwamafutha e-transformer.

Ukususwa okuphumelelayo: Ukusebenzisa i-nano molecular material filtration kanye ne-complex three-dimensional flash evaporation technology, amanzi, igesi, nokungcola kuwoyela we-transformer kususwa kahle, kuthuthukisa kakhulu amandla okumelana nokucindezela kanye nekhwalithi kawoyela.

Ukulawula Okukhaliphile: Ukulawula okuhlakaniphile kwe-PLC ngokuzithandela, ukusebenza kwesikrini esithintwayo, nesibonisi esiguqukayo, okwenza ukusebenza kube lula futhi kuhlakaniphe.

Idizayini eyenziwe ngabantu: Imishini ifaka umsindo ophansi, ukusebenza okulula, izikhawu zokulungisa ezinde, nokusetshenziswa kwamandla okuphansi, kunciphisa izindleko zokusebenza.

Ukuvikelwa kokuphepha: Wonke umshini ufakwe ukuvikela okuxhumene kokuphepha, okubandakanya ukuvikela okuxhumene kohlelo lokukhipha uwoyela, isistimu ye-vacuum, nesistimu yokufudumeza, kanye nokuvuza nokulayishwa kwemishini yokuvala, ukuze kuqinisekiswe ukusebenza okuphephile kwemishini.

Ukusetshenziswa kwesihlungi sikawoyela we-vacuum esinezigaba ezimbili se-ZYD

Isihlungi sikawoyela we-vacuum esisebenza kahle kakhulu se-ZYD sisetshenziswa kabanzi ezimbonini zikagesi, eziteshini zikagesi, ezinkampanini zamandla, ezisansimbi, ezamakhemikhali kaphethiloli, imishini, ezokuthutha, izitimela nezinye izimboni, ikakhulukazi ukugcinwa endaweni yokugcinwa kwama-transformer eziteshini ezinkulu ezingaphezu kuka-110KV, njengoba kanye nokwelashwa okujulile kokuhlanzeka kwamafutha amasha wezinga eliphezulu, uwoyela ongenisiwe, uwoyela we-transformer, uwoyela we-ultra-high pressure transformer neminye imikhiqizo kawoyela. Ngaphezu kwalokho, idivayisi ingasetshenziselwa umjovo kawoyela we-vacuum nokomisa ama-transformer, futhi ingafinyelela ukusebenza bukhoma kusayithi.

Izinyathelo zokusebenzisaI-ZYD yokuhlunga uwoyela we-vacuum enezigaba ezimbili ezisebenza kahle kakhulu

Izinyathelo zokusetshenziswa kwesihlungi sikawoyela we-vacuum esisebenza kahle kakhulu se-ZYD esinezigaba ezimbili ngokuvamile sihlanganisa ukulungiselela, ukuqalisa i-vacuum, ukufudumeza nokuhlunga, kanye nokuvala shaqa. Izinyathelo eziqondile zimi kanje:

Ukulungiselela: Xhuma amapayipi kawoyela angenayo nephumayo ukuze uqinisekise ukuthi ugesi ulungile.

Qala i-vacuum: Vula iphampu ye-vacuum ukuze usungule indawo ye-vacuum.

Ukushisa nokuhlunga: Qala ipompo likawoyela, futhi amafutha azoshiswa futhi ahlungwe ukuze kukhishwe ukungcola.

Ukuvala shaqa: Ngemva kokuqedwa kokuhlunga uwoyela, vala isistimu ngayinye ngokulandelana, hlanza isihlungi sikawoyela, futhi unqamule ukunikezwa kwamandla.

Izinketho zokucushwa ze-ZYD zokuhlunga uwoyela we-vacuum ezinezigaba ezimbili ezisebenza kahle kakhulu

Ngokwezidingo zabasebenzisi,I-ZYD yokuhlunga uwoyela we-vacuum enezigaba ezimbili ezisebenza kahle kakhuluingahlonywa ukucushwa okuhlukahlukene, okufana nomtshina womswakama we-inthanethi, i-frequency converter, imitha yokugeleza enomsebenzi wokuqongelela, isistimu ye-vacuum ye-transformer yangaphandle, njll. Ngaphezu kwalokho, isakhiwo sonke singenziwa futhi sibe amafomu ahlukahlukene njengeselula, ehleliwe, i-trailer, njll ukuze kuhlangatshezwane nezidingo zabasebenzisi abahlukene.
